Below you will find effective solutions to <strong>TURN ON USB Debugging on Locked Android phone<\/strong>.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><strong><em>But before that let us know what USB Debugging on Android means?<\/em><\/strong><\/p>\n<blockquote>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><strong>Additional Reading: <a href=\"https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/unlock-android-phone-without-factory-reset\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">How To Unlock Android Phone If It Gets Locked Due To Any Possible Reasons<\/a><br \/>\n<\/strong><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: justify;\">What is USB Debugging Mode?<\/h3>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><strong>USB Debugging Mode<\/strong> is a mode that can be turned ON after connecting Android device directly to PC. Once, connected you can transfer files from your Android to computer. However, the main function of this mode is to <strong>establish connection between and Android device and a PC with Android SDK<\/strong> (software development kit). Android SDK is a software suite that made to help in the development of Android apps.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Please note that the main function about USB debugging is to establish a connection between PC and Android and it is ready to make deeper level actions.<\/p>\n<blockquote>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><strong>Additional Reading: <a href=\"https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/9-amazing-hidden-features-of-samsung-galaxy-samsung-galaxy-tips-tricks\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">9 Amazing Hidden Features of Samsung Galaxy: [Samsung Galaxy Tips &amp; Tricks]<\/a><br \/>\n<\/strong><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: justify;\">Solutions To Enable USB Debugging on Locked Android Phone<\/h2>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">So, now coming back to the topic, here I am providing working solutions that will help you to enable usb debugging on locked Android phone \u2013 <strong>whether you have forgotten password, PIN, fingerprint or pattern lock<\/strong>.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: justify;\">Solution No. #1 \u2013 Remove Android Device\u2019s Screen Lock First By Using Android Lock Screen Removal Software<\/h3>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">If your phone is locked then you have to first follow the solutions mentioned here to get rid of locked screen \u2013 <a href=\"https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/learn-to-disable-screen-locks-of-android-devices\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><strong>How to Remove or Bypass Android Screen Locks &#8211; [PIN, Pattern, Password or Fingerprints]<\/strong><\/a><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">We recommend you to use <a href=\"https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/android-unlock.php\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><strong>Android Lock Screen Removal Software<\/strong>,<\/a> because it is easy to understand and very fast and you don\u2019t have to follow any hectic process.<\/p>\n<div><center><a href='https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/free-download-for-windows' style=\"color: #fff;\" target='_blank'>btn_img<img class='size-full wp-image-138' src='https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/05\/download-win.jpg' alt='free-download-win'><\/a><a href='https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/free-download-for-mac' style=\"color: #fff;\">btn_img<img class='size-full wp-image-139 alignnone' style='margin-left:20px;' src='https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/05\/download-mac.jpg' alt='free-download-mac'><\/a><\/center><\/div>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Below find out the step-by-step guide on how to remove screen lock from Android.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: justify;\">Steps to Remove Locked Screen From Android Device<\/h3>\n<h2>Part 1- Unlock Phone Screen Without Data Loss<\/h2>\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p>\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3>Step 1 - Connect the Locked Android Phone to PC<\/h3>Launch <b>Android Unlock Tool<\/b> on your PC then choose '<b>Screen Unlock<\/b>' option among various tools.<br><br>\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<center><img loading='lazy' src='https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/images\/screenshots\/unlock\/unlock-1-drf.jpg' \/><\/center><br>\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\tAfter that, connect your locked Android device to the PC with the help of USB cable. <\/strong><\/p>\n<blockquote>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><strong>Additional Reading: <a href=\"https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/sim-unlock-android-phones-without-code-2\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">3 Effective Ways to Unlock Android Sim Lock Without Code<\/a><br \/>\n<\/strong><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: justify;\">Solution No. #2 &#8211; Enable USB Debugging By Entering Into Recovery Mode<\/h3>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">This is another solution, in which you have to <a href=\"https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/solved-no-command-error-in-recovery-mode-on-android\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><strong>enter into recovery mode<\/strong><\/a> and <strong>perform wipe data\/factory reset process<\/strong> in order to get rid of locked screen on Android device.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Below find out the steps how to wipe data\/factory reset:<\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li><strong>Switch OFF<\/strong> your Android phone.<\/li>\n<li>Now press following key combination to <strong>get into recovery mode<\/strong>. The key combination differs from phone to phone. One of the popular combinations is \u201c<strong>Power Button + Volume Up Button + Volume Down Button<\/strong>\u201d, but you must check online which key combination work for your phone model.<\/li>\n<li>The <strong>Android bootloader menu<\/strong> will open. Select the \u201c<strong>Recovery mode<\/strong>\u201d and press the power button to enter into recovery mode.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ter size-full wp-image-4844\" src=\"https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2017\/05\/Factory-Reset-To-Disable-Android-Forgotten-Lock-Screen-copy.jpg\" alt=\"Factory-Reset-To-Disable-Android-Forgotten-Lock-Screen\" width=\"541\" height=\"473\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2017\/05\/Factory-Reset-To-Disable-Android-Forgotten-Lock-Screen-copy.jpg 541w, https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2017\/05\/Factory-Reset-To-Disable-Android-Forgotten-Lock-Screen-copy-300x262.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 541px) 100vw, 541px\" \/><\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li>Once, you enter into recovery mode, you can use <strong>Volume down<\/strong> button to scroll down and press <strong>Power button<\/strong> to select \u201c<strong>Wipe Data\/Factory Reset<\/strong>\u201d option.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ter size-full wp-image-4845\" src=\"https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2017\/05\/Factory-Reset-To-Bypass-Android-Forgotten-Lock-Screen.jpg\" alt=\"Factory-Reset-To-Bypass-Android-Forgotten-Lock-Screen\" width=\"650\" height=\"337\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2017\/05\/Factory-Reset-To-Bypass-Android-Forgotten-Lock-Screen.jpg 650w, https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2017\/05\/Factory-Reset-To-Bypass-Android-Forgotten-Lock-Screen-300x156.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 650px) 100vw, 650px\" \/><\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li>Once, you confirm the <strong>wipe data\/factory reset<\/strong>, your device will start the process.<\/li>\n<li>Once, the process gets complete, <strong>reboot your device<\/strong>.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">After performing the above process, you will be able to Turn On your Android phone normally and you do not have to enter any password, pin, pattern lock or fingerprint lock.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">After this you can follow the <strong>solution 1<\/strong> mentioned above to <strong>Enable USB debugging on your Android phone or tablet<\/strong>.<\/p>\n<blockquote>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><strong>Additional Reading: <a href=\"https:\/\/www.androiddata-recovery.com\/blog\/how-to-fix-unfortunately-app-has-stopped-error\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">How To Fix \u201cUnfortunately App has Stopped\u201d Error in Android Without losing data<\/a><br \/>\n<\/strong><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: justify;\">Things To Consider While Performing Solution 2<\/h3>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">I would suggest this solution as a last option, because <strong>performing<\/strong> <strong>wipe data\/factory reset deletes entire data stored within the phone<\/strong>. Remember that ADB is enabled automatically while you use Apply update from ADB option in stock recovery regardless of whether its active or not in Settings.                    <\/p>\n                <\/div>\n            <\/div>\n        <\/section>\n\t\t        <section class=\"sc_fs_faq sc_card \">\n            <div>\n\t\t\t\t<h3>Is it safe to enable USB debugging?<\/h3>                <div>\n\t\t\t\t\t                    <p>\n\t\t\t\t\t\tYes, it is safe to enable USB debugging but there is a risk too. Especially when you plug your phone into public charging port then it can create problems. This is because if someone has access to that port then they can steal some confidential data or information from a device or even may put some harmful apps into it.                     <\/p>\n                <\/div>\n            <\/div>\n        <\/section>\n\t\t\n<script type=\"application\/ld+json\">\n    {\n\t\t\"@context\": \"https:\/\/schema.org\",\n\t\t\"@type\": \"FAQPage\",\n\t\t\"mainEntity\": [\n\t\t\t\t{\n\t\t\t\t\"@type\": \"Question\",\n\t\t\t\t\"name\": \"Can I Enable USB debugging using ADB?\",\n\t\t\t\t\"acceptedAnswer\": {\n\t\t\t\t\t\"@type\": \"Answer\",\n\t\t\t\t\t\"text\": \"There are step by step guide to enable USB debugging using ADB command.
